How much does it cost to hire a landscaper in Corona, California?

In California, sod installation typically runs $1,200 to $4,800 when you hire a pro, and about $500 to $1,800 if you do it yourself. Corona prices track the California range, with larger metros toward the high end. Size it to your own home with our free calculator.

Should I DIY or hire a landscaper in Corona?

Sod installation is rated moderate for a DIYer. Doing it yourself can save the gap between $500 to $1,800 and $1,200 to $4,800, but landscapers bring tools, permits, and a warranty. For a large or time-sensitive job, a local pro in Corona is usually the safer call. Our free DIY-or-hire calculator walks through it.
